Sažetak
Reproduction of greater gamut enables in principle the more accurate information transfer of colour of original. According to that, the opinion exists that greater gamut means greater intensity of quality reproduction experience. However, the intensity of some reproduction quality depends on some other parameters. In this sense the focus of that work is to explain interrelations of the point of view connected to gamut size, rendering methods and situiations in whic the prints with image presentations that cause the psycho-physical effect of chromatic induction are evaluated.
